Jason S. Babcock is a scholar working on Cognitive Neuroscience, Computer Vision and Pattern Recognition and Human-Computer Interaction. According to data from OpenAlex, Jason S. Babcock has authored 15 papers receiving a total of 188 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Cognitive Neuroscience, 6 papers in Computer Vision and Pattern Recognition and 6 papers in Human-Computer Interaction. Recurrent topics in Jason S. Babcock’s work include Visual perception and processing mechanisms (7 papers), Gaze Tracking and Assistive Technology (6 papers) and Visual Attention and Saliency Detection (4 papers). Jason S. Babcock is often cited by papers focused on Visual perception and processing mechanisms (7 papers), Gaze Tracking and Assistive Technology (6 papers) and Visual Attention and Saliency Detection (4 papers). Jason S. Babcock collaborates with scholars based in United States, France and Malaysia. Jason S. Babcock's co-authors include Jeff B. Pelz, Michael L. Platt, John Pearson, Gail L. Patricelli, Jessica L. Yorzinski, Roxanne L. Canosa, Mark D. Fairchild, Alejandro Jaimes, Shih‐Fu Chang and Marc Eaddy and has published in prestigious journals such as Journal of Experimental Biology, Journal of Vision and CiteSeer X (The Pennsylvania State University).
